To effectively understand your audience, organizations must engage in responsible listening and observation. This includes gathering qualitative and quantitative data through surveys, focus groups, social media monitoring, and analytics tools. By analyzing this data, brands can segment their customers, identify key demographics, and uncover hidden insights. For instance, recognizing that a specific age group values sustainability or another demographic prioritizes personalized experiences can shape product development, marketing strategies, and overall brand messaging. This level of understanding is crucial for developing innovative, relevant, and impactful solutions that truly resonate with consumers.

Measuring Impact: Analyzing Success and Iterating for Growth

In the realm of forward-thinking brand strategy, measuring impact is not merely an afterthought but a cornerstone of premier problem solvers. It involves meticulously analyzing success metrics to understand what’s working and what needs adjustment. This data-driven approach allows brands to make informed decisions, pivot when necessary, and ensure their strategies remain relevant in a dynamic market. By leveraging tools like Google Analytics, social media insights, and customer feedback platforms, businesses can track key performance indicators (KPIs) such as website traffic, conversion rates, and customer satisfaction scores.
The analysis of these metrics goes beyond simple numbers. It involves interpreting trends, identifying patterns, and attributing success or challenges to specific initiatives. For instance, a brand might discover that an email marketing campaign drove significant sales growth by analyzing click-through rates and purchase conversions. This knowledge becomes the foundation for future campaigns, fostering a continuous cycle of improvement. Responsible brand strategies further emphasize the importance of ethical considerations, ensuring that success is measured not just in commercial terms but also in terms of social and environmental impact, reinforcing their commitment to value-based practices.
Iterating for growth is where successful brands truly differentiate themselves. They don’t rest on past achievements; instead, they use insights from impact analysis to refine and innovate. This process involves refining existing strategies, introducing new initiatives, and adapting to market shifts. For example, a brand that observes high customer churn in a specific segment might address this by enhancing product offerings or implementing loyalty programs tailored to those customers.
